Dolmen du Mas d'Arjac in Cabrerets
Dolmens
46330 Cabrerets

The dolmens of the Mas d'Arjac, the megalithic ensemble of the Neolithic in Cabrerets (Lot), include three funerary monuments, one of which has been registered with the Historical Monuments since 1966.
Archaeological site of the Dolmen des Aguals or the Combe de l'Ours (also on Montbrun commune)
Dolmens
46160 Montbrun

The Dolmen des Aguals, located in Montbrun and Gréalou (Lot), is an exceptional megalithic monument of Neolithic and Chalcolithic, combining Quercy architecture and Atlantic influences. Listed at Historic Monuments in 2001.
Pierre Martine de Liverpool
Dolmens
46320 Livernon

The Pierre Martine is a neolithic dolmen located in Liverpool (Lot, Occitanie), classified as a historical monument since 1889. With its 20-ton slab, it is the largest dolmen in the department, testifying to the regional megalithic architecture.
Two dolmens on the Gabaudet estate
Dolmens
46500 Issendolus

The two dolmens of Gabaudet, located at Issendolus in the Lot, are megalithic monuments dated to the Neolithic. Ranked Historical Monuments in 1934, they bear witness to an ancient human occupation in this karst region of Quercy.
Dolmen dit Peyrelevade, formerly on plot B 4 of the commune of Roussayrolles
Pierre levée
81140 Vaour

The Dolmen de Peyrelevade, also known as Jayantière, is a megalithic monument of the Neolithic near Vaour, in the Tarn. This dolmen, the largest in the department, bears witness to the ancient funeral practices of the region.
6 Dolmens de Saint-Chels
Dolmens
46160 Saint-Chels

The 6 dolmens of Saint-Chels, built in the Neolithic, form a remarkable megalithic ensemble located in the Lot, in Occitanie. These funeral monuments bear witness to an ancient occupation of Cajarc causse, between the Lot and Célé valleys.
Dolmen du Rat in Saint-Sulpice
Dolmens
46160 Saint-Sulpice

The dolmen du Rat, located in Saint-Sulpice in the Lot, is a megalithic monument of the recent Neolithic and Chalcolithic, inscribed in historical monuments since 2011, remarkable for its tumulus and aniconic stele.
Dolmen de Pech de Grammont à Gramat
Dolmens
46500 Gramat

The Dolmen de Pech de Grammont, located in Gramat (Lot, Occitanie), is a megalithic monument emblematic of the recent Neolithic and Chalcolithic, famous for its double dolmen structure and its unique Quercy hub-stone. Joined Historic Monuments in 2012.
